Regional Manager, ArcHeritage

Job Description

Job Title: Regional Manager, ArcHeritage

Salary: £33,000 - 39,000 p.a depending upon skills and experience

Reporting to: Chief Executive Officer

Responsible for: Project Managers, Project Officers, Project Supervisors, Archaeologists (and others if team shape changes)

Role summary: To lead the strategic direction and development of ArcHeritage, generating new revenue streams and ensuring the department’s sustainability. To manage the projects, people, external relationships, financial and operational issues and achieve the Charity’s objectives.

Key Duties & Responsibilites

·  Be responsible for the development and sustainability of ArcHeritage, and ensure that this also achieves the strategic aims of the Trust as a whole.

·  Be responsible for strategic policy initiatives including contributing at Trust-wide level.

·  Report regularly through to the executive team regarding activity, projects financial performance and staffing issues.

·  Promote and contribute to the archaeological and heritage understanding of the region.

·  Identify opportunities for income generation including developing alternate revenue streams.

·  Be responsible for the overall financial performance of the office, but devolve budgetary management on a project-by project basis as appropriate.

·  Generate and maintain new client contacts and develop new relationships, partnerships and business opportunities.

·  Secure external project funding (including research projects) through successful proposals and tenders.

·  Ensure that staff training needs are met, and that the skills cohere as a group to enable ArcHeritage to operate successfully within the profession, to high standard.

·  Develop and maintain a portfolio of work that is sustainable, contains niche specialisms and high value outputs and contributes to the Trust's wider social objectives.

·  Encourage and facilitate inter-office working and the sharing of expertise within the Trust.

·  Produce costings and project designs and information for tenders for larger and strategic projects.

·  Ensure effective multi project management and accurate tracking.

·  Have responsibility for some operations management through liaison with the Operations Manager.

·  Ensure compliance with Trust policies including Health & Safety, Environmental, Equal Opps, Anti Harassment and Bullying, UK working validity, Data Protection and others.

·  Liaise with the Head of Marketing on PR strategy.

·  Represent ArcHeritage and the Trust in the public sphere as part of outreach activities. This includes giving public lecture/talks and other community activities as required.

·  Any other duties/tasks that may be reasonably requested by line managers.
